POSITION DESCRIPTION
Position title: Experienced Engineer/ Maintenance Technician
POSITION PURPOSE:
The installation and repair of all building systems, to ensure a safe, efficient, and comfortable operation of the hotel according to Residence Inn Columbus at Easton, Olshan Properties, and Marriott Hotels’ standards. Perform preventative maintenance on all assigned equipment.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:
Perform preventative maintenance to assigned equipment. Interact with the Area Director of Engineering and the Assistant Area Director of Engineering to assist in start-up, shutdown, and operation of assigned equipment. Read gauges, meters, dials, and make basic mathematical calculations, to ensure that the equipment is operating at peak efficiency. Perform visual inspections of assigned area on a daily basis. Keep in contact with the departmental managers of the assigned area and address any concerns that a manager may have.
Respond to guest and departmental calls in a polite, professional, and timely manner. Identify, troubleshoot, and correctly solve any situation that may arise during the shift.
Support the GXP Program throughout the hotel. Learn and utilize all essential functions of GXP from accepting, starting, stopping if needed, adding notes, adding pictures, etc. on all Service orders and PM orders.
Give all Emergencies & Guest Occupied rooms the Highest Priority.
Check work orders daily to follow up on any that needed parts or any that may be left from the previous day. Perform repair work given on all service orders and PM Orders and ensure all work is completed in a timely manner.
Perform any special tasks (projects) as assigned by the Area Director of Engineering or Assistant Director of Engineering. These may include, but not limited to, ceiling tile replacement, renovation and restoration projects, moving heavy equipment, etc.

SPECIFIC JOB K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S AND ABILITIES
The individual must possess the following knowledge, skills and abilities and be able to explain and demonstrate that he or she can perform the essential functions of the job, with or without reasonable accommodations, using some other combination of skills and abilities.
Possess advanced knowledge of electrical and mechanical systems with the ability to analyze their design intent and performance.
Possess advanced knowledge of construction and building systems.
Possess advanced knowledge of the carpentry, painting, commercial heating and air conditioning, plumbing, and electrical disciplines.
Possess advanced knowledge and skill with both hand operated and electrical equipment and the ability to instruct subordinates in the proper and safe usage of said equipment.
Ability to apply technical knowledge of federal and state regulations to practical situations within the hospitality industry.
Ability to react quickly/decisively to changes in the Engineering Department and Hotel.
Ability to perform tasks while bending, stooping, kneeling, or standing while supporting additional weight up to 25 lbs.
Ability to perform duties in a confined space and in an awkward position.
Ability to climb stairs, ladders or use a man lift to work at heights up to 30 feet, often reaching overhead.
Ability to push, pull, grasp, lift, and/or otherwise move supplies and equipment weighing up to 75 lbs., occasionally waist high.
Ability to concentrate in high-pressure possibly dangerous area.
Ability to communicate telephonically, face-to-face, and over a hand-held two way radio.
Ability to hear a change in pitch of high-speed mechanical equipment.
Visual ability to read manufacturer’s instructions, correspondence, schematics, blueprints, etc. Visual ability to determine wire colors for safe repair and detect emergency situations.
Ability to write and speak English, to comprehend and communicate instructions to both the hotel and it’s clients.
Ability to remain calm in emergency situations and to effectively deal with the internal and external guests, some of whom require patience, tact and diplomacy to defuse anger, collect accurate information, and solve guest concerns.
Ability to work under time constraints and deadlines, must be productive in quantity and quality of work.
Ability to work in a 365 day 24 hour environment.
Ability to translate technical information or problems into layman’s terms.
Ability to use finger/hand movements for extended periods of time. Finger and hand dexterity to manipulate switches, writing instruments, a computer keyboard, etc.
Knowledge of GXP system.
Knowledge and proper usage of Lock Out/ Tag Out training.
Protect employer’s privacy and data; keep passwords safe.
QUALIFICATION STANDARDS
Education: High School degree or equivalent. Apprenticeship and/or advanced training program for operating engineers recognized by the industry preferred.
Experience: Minimum of 3 years combination of work experience in commercial buildings with complex electrical, plumbing, H.V.A.C. systems, and carpentry.
Licenses or Certificates: No Licenses required for this position. Electrical License, Refrigeration License, Fire Safety License, and Professional Engineering License preferred.
